VIVA Rewa Soccer president Pranil Singh says the inclusion of former Kossa, Zome Mars striker and beach wonder boy James Naka along with midfielder George Lui would boost their chances of winning in their first match tomorrow.
Mr Singh said James Naka had been cleared to play while partner George Lui was awaiting his International Clearance which should have been finalised by yesterday.
He said the duo are both experienced players and will certainly boost their chances of securing a victory.
"We would like to improve on our performance from last season and this is one way we hope to do this.
"We have our local boys and having the two Solomon Islanders joining us would be a great boost as we also seek to boost the confidence of our younger players," Singh said.
He said his side is a new delta squad and the players are ready to give Rewa supporters the best on this first game against Suva.
He said do respect Suva being a very strong side also and they will be out to give a good game against them.
Viva Rewa takes on BIC Power Electric Suva in the opening of the FijiSun/Weet-Bix National Football League at the Vodafone Ratu Cakobau Park on Sunday.
Naka could be in Fiji until the end of the year playing with Rewa in the league and various competitions.
The game kicks off at the Ratu Cakobau Park at 3.30pm on Sunday.
